Output e9409b312d0012ec3fc76cf6ae4df9327ff25bee054816b86ed3e75ab23c15bb:7

value
33586297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f98ae74c689f409ba60ba375deaf38964267ab7 OP_EQUAL
address
MSpq1dhXqABXVRkG5mHHHZxBQdWwsgYxzz
transaction
e9409b312d0012ec3fc76cf6ae4df9327ff25bee054816b86ed3e75ab23c15bb
spent
true